Step into the unparalleled charm of 36 Low Mill, a distinctive two-bedroom apartment nestled within the prestigious Grade II listed Low Mill. Originally constructed in the late 1700s and meticulously converted by John Collis in 1994, this exceptional residence is steeped in history while offering modern comforts. Set amidst six acres of beautifully maintained communal grounds, the property enjoys an elevated position overlooking the scenic River Lune, with the vibrant city of Lancaster just a stone's throw away.
